What is club security?

Club security, often referred to as bouncers or security personnel, are responsible for maintaining safety and order within nightclubs, bars, and similar venues. Their duties include checking IDs at the entrance, managing crowd control, handling difficult situations, and ensuring that patrons follow the club’s rules. They also intervene in conflicts, prevent unauthorized entry, and cooperate with local law enforcement if necessary. Club security helps create a safe environment for guests and staff.

Club Security primarily focuses on maintaining safety in nightlife venues, handling crowd control, and preventing disturbances. Hotel Security, on the other hand, emphasizes guest safety, access control, and property protection within hospitality settings. While both roles require security licenses and conflict resolution skills, their work environments and daily responsibilities differ significantly, aligning with their respective industries.

What are the most common challenges faced by club security personnel, and how can they be effectively managed?

Club security personnel often face challenges such as managing large, sometimes unpredictable crowds, handling difficult or intoxicated patrons, and maintaining a safe environment while remaining approachable. These challenges can be effectively managed through ongoing training in conflict resolution, communication, and de-escalation techniques. Additionally, teamwork and clear protocols for handling incidents help ensure that situations are addressed promptly and safely, supporting both the club's patrons and staff.

Job description

Job Summary

The myViejas Club Supervisor supervises the Club Hosts and carries out supervisory responsibilities in accordance with the organization's policies and procedures. Responsibilities include interviewing, hiring, and training team members; planning, assigning, and directing work; appraising performance; rewarding and disciplining team members; addressing complaints and resolving problems. Trains and informs Club Hosts on all new programs, promotions and special events. Provides on-going guidance concerning guest hospitality and service; ensures that guests have a favorable gaming experience by providing personalized and preferential guest service; builds strong relationships with guests to promote return trips to the Casino.

Job Description

Supervise the activities of the Club Hosts which include scheduling work, hiring, motivating, and appraising their performance. Complies with and ensures that all staff follows all casino and departmental policies and procedures. Provides daily written or verbal communications to inform team members of all special events, promotions, programs and activities within the casino and VOC. Provides on-going guidance concerning guest hospitality and service. Ensures that all casino from line team members understand how myViejas operates, including the benefits of the club and various techniques for encouraging guests to sign up for a player's club card.Makes appropriate decisions regarding complimentary by evaluating the gaming activity of individual players such as recorded play, earned points, comp availability, and guest profitability.Adheres to guest complimentary guidelines as defined by management.Ensures that guests have a favorable gaming experience by providing excellent and personalized guest service. Create a fun and exciting atmosphere by assisting with special events and promotions as needed, while maintaining a professional, friendly and courteous manner at all times.Timely responds and resolves guest inquiries and disputes/issues regarding player's account, point discrepancies or related while ensuring guest satisfaction.Ensures that all bus tour guests are appropriately signed up for myViejas and monitors the guests' play in accordance with the tour bus policy.Observe any wrong doing or irregularities that may take place on the Casino floor. Works with the other myViejas Supervisors to maintain the integrity of the player tracking system including any other information that may affect the functioning of the myViejas Club. Coordinates with Surveillance and Security with code X and card fraud issues.While on the floor, actively seeks guests that are not in the myViejas Club and utilizes strong sales tactics to promote the myViejas rewards and sign-up new members. Maintain inventory and order supplies as needed. Stock the booths, and change the embossers and printer ribbons. Check that all the equipment is working properly and call IT with any issues.Maintains open communication with Marketing staff and other operational departments.Maintains the knowledge of and ensures the team member is aware of marketing promotions, and changes related to the casino policies and procedures. Performs other related and compatible duties as assigned.Excellent verbal, written, and interpersonal communication skills.Excellent organizational skills.Ability to manage multiple tasks.Ability to problem-solve, make decisions, and manage conflict.Ability to maintain confidentiality in handling sensitive information.Must be able to work flexible schedule according to business needs, including evenings, weekends, and holidays.
